Why Choose Liberty’s Music Education in Conducting Master’s Degree?

If you are looking to teach music at the university level or work in music education administration, you will need a master’s degree. The program at Liberty University is designed to prepare you for career opportunities in public or private schools and in higher education settings. This means you are preparing for prestigious academic positions that often do not require teacher licensure.

Courses include

  • Graduate Conducting
  • Ensemble Pedagogy
  • Graduate Ensemble
  • Entrepreneurism in Music

Career Opportunities

  • Collegiate music educator
  • Director of community music arts program
  • Music education supervisor
  • Professional music education consultant
  • School music administrator

Minimum Requirements

  • Admission application
  • Self-certification form(for students who are in the final term of their bachelor’s degree)
  • Current Liberty undergraduate students seeking preliminary acceptance into a graduate program must complete a degree completion application through their ASIST account
  • Completion of an earned baccalaureate degree from an institution accredited by an agency recognized by the U.S. Department of Education in one of the following areas: bachelor’s degree in music, music education, or music and worship
  • 3.0 GPA for admission in good standing
